In a chemical reaction, several aspects can change, including:
1. **Chemical Composition**: The substances involved in the reaction (reactants) are transformed into different substances (products) with distinct chemical compositions.
2. **Chemical Bonds**: The breaking of bonds in the reactants and the formation of new bonds in the products occur during the reaction.
3. **Energy Changes**: Reactions often involve changes in energy, which can manifest as heat release (exothermic reactions) or heat absorption (endothermic reactions).
4. **Physical Properties**: Changes in color, temperature, state (solid, liquid, gas), and odor may occur as a result of a chemical reaction.
5. **Concentration of Reactants and Products**: The amounts of reactants decrease while the amounts of products increase over the course of the reaction.
6. **Equilibrium Position**: In reversible reactions, the balance between reactants and products can shift based on changes in conditions like concentration, temperature, or pressure.
Overall, the essence of a chemical reaction is the transformation of substances, reflected in changes to their chemical identity and physical properties.
